The figure below shows the value of sedimentary structures in relative age dating. A cliff face exposing horizontal rock (left side) might be incorrectly interpreted as undeformed horizontal strata without the top-and-bottom information that proves the layers have been folded and some must have been overturned. The right side of the figure shows what the geologist might have seen had the adjacent rocks not been eroded away or covered by glacial deposits. Number the layers, with 1 representing the oldest rock. Which is the youngest?
